An 85-year-old grandmother sued the makers of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as, saying they deceived her by selling a game that contained hidden sex scenes. Florence Cohen says she bought the offending game for her 14-year-old grandson back when it was rated for 17-year-olds or older, not knowing it would ultimately become an Adults Only game.
